The Driftnet sweeper scans for orphaned volumes, stale load balancers, and unattached IPs left behind by failed deploys. Each sweep cycle currently handles one region at a time to keep API rate limits comfortable; a full pass takes roughly four hours. If cleanup lags and costs spike, on-call may shorten the cycle interval, but watch the API throttle metrics. Current sweep parameters are set as follows.

tuning table, kajog-bawip:
TIERS = {
    "kelius": 256,
    "lammir": 543,
}

**Q: Why do Fernwick handlers sometimes take several seconds on first invocation?**

A: Cold starts happen when the Lattice runtime spins up a fresh container for a handler that hasn't run recently. Expect this on the Quillbrook staging stack, where traffic is sparse. Keep dependencies lean and avoid heavy init code. If a cold start stalls past the timeout, you may need the recovery vault. The passphrase for that vault is below.

unlock words, tawif-tahop: oliys-ulawyn-tamdor-lamys-casox-jormir-fraius-kasath-ulador-ulamir-holir-sorys-holeth

Onboarding note for the Ledgerpane admin table: bulk edits are applied through the batcher service, not directly against the database. Select rows, choose an action, and the batcher stages changes in a pending set you can review before commit. Edits over 500 rows require a second approver — this is enforced server-side, so don't try to chunk around it. To run the batcher locally you need the staging write credential, which goes in your .env as the next line.

secret setting of bahip-kagag: RELAY_SECRET3=c83